Abstract:
Abstract The sneaker industry is one of the industries that is likely to be influenced significantly by the emergence of the metaverse. This study explores the potential business opportunities of the metaverse for the sneaker industry. The outcomes are based on seven open interviews with experts on the topic, which have helped identify and explore numerous novel business opportunities. The opportunities have been categorised into: Sales of virtual sneakers, Enhanced feedback, Improved product development, Brand interaction, Engaging advertisements, Increased personalisation, and Immersive shopping experience. This paper expanded the current knowledge about the potential for business growth that the metaverse holds for the sneaker industry, with comprehensive analysis of the business opportunities.
